"I am a transit bus operator (UTA). Today as I pulled up to a bus stop in Bountiful, Utah, I saw into the garage of a home adjacent to the bus stop. Situated inside the garage was a couple tables with canned and boxed foods, juices, water, diapers, wipes, hygiene products, and even the prized toilet paper.
There was a sign on the table the read—FREE for those who need it, take what you can use, leave something if you can (or something like that).
I know that several people on my bus were all in less than ideal circumstances, among them an elderly man in a wheelchair who lives in a dive motel in Swede town, a homeless teen and a single mom doing her best.
I pointed out the table and sign to these folks, in disbelief they exited the bus and took only what they needed and came back to the bus with very big smiles on their faces, they were so grateful to this kind and generous gesture. I was humbled at their reactions and today my heart is full.
Thank you to the fine people in that home who showed selflessness and love for our brothers and sisters."

Willie Nelson, the renowned country music artist, is the proud owner of a vast 700-acre ranch in Texas, aptly named Luck. This name is particularly appropriate for the 70 horses that reside there, each possessing a unique story of survival. These horses are treated with the utmost care, receiving hand-fed meals twice daily and enjoying a level of attention that surpasses the norm. The ranch serves as a tranquil refuge, featuring expansive farmland where the horses can roam, graze, and thrive in a natural environment. What distinguishes this sanctuary is its noble purpose: nearly all of these horses have been rescued from slaughterhouses, spared from a dire fate, and granted a renewed opportunity for life.
Under Nelson's stewardship, they spend their days in comfort, enveloped in affection and the stunning landscape of Texas. For Nelson, Luck represents more than just a name; it symbolizes his deep compassion and commitment to these animals, who exemplify the essence of resilience.
Willie Nelson once said, "My horses are probably the luckiest horses in the world. They get hand-fed twice a day, and they were just about to be sent to slaughter, which is probably the last thing they remember. So, they're happy horses." His words reflect a profound bond with these animals. For Nelson, horses are more than just creatures of work or leisure—they are companions who have been given a second chance at life.
